Transaction 8dbf309f9d9556c28a7e214b1522439ade327b94a4007ea1f0fbdfb61bf8aa60

1 Input
1 Outputs
  • 8dbf309f9d9556c28a7e214b1522439ade327b94a4007ea1f0fbdfb61bf8aa60:0
  • value  1509290
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G